What does dreaming about tornado mean?
Dreaming of a tornado generally symbolizes intense emotions, internal conflicts, or life situations that feel out of control. The tornado represents destructive forces that threaten to sweep away the established order, but it can also indicate the need for radical change. The tornado's location (near, far, inside a house) and your reaction to it are crucial for interpretation. From a positive perspective, a tornado in dreams can symbolize necessary cleansing of old patterns, beliefs, or relationships that no longer serve you. It represents the transformative force that, although frightening, can create space for new growth. Many people report tornado dreams during periods of significant transition, such as career changes, relationship endings, or moments of self-discovery. The size, color, and behavior of the tornado offer additional clues. A small tornado may represent a manageable problem, while a massive one suggests a major crisis. A black tornado often symbolizes depression or despair, while a white one might indicate spiritual purification. If the tornado is chasing you, it may reflect feelings of being cornered by external circumstances. Finally, the dream's outcome is significant. Does the tornado destroy everything? Do you miraculously survive? Do you observe from a safe place? These variations indicate your level of preparedness to face challenges and your capacity for resilience in chaotic situations in your waking life.
Psychological Interpretation
According to Carl Jung
From a Jungian perspective, the tornado represents the collective shadow and archetypal forces of chaos. Carl Jung would see this symbol as a manifestation of the unconscious attempting to balance an overly rigid or controlled psyche. The tornado symbolizes the 'psychic storm' necessary to dissolve obsolete ego structures and allow for individuation. It represents the transformative power of the Self that, although destructive in appearance, serves a higher purpose of psychological integration.
According to Sigmund Freud
Sigmund Freud would interpret the tornado as a symbol of repressed sexual impulses and uncontrolled libidinal energy. The phallic shape and swirling motion of the tornado would represent unconscious sexual desires that threaten to destabilize the dreamer's conscious life. Freud might also link it to childhood traumas or unresolved Oedipal conflicts that 'swirl' in the unconscious, creating anxiety that manifests as images of natural destruction in dreams.
Modern Psychology
Modern psychology sees the dream tornado as a metaphor for post-traumatic stress, generalized anxiety, or mood disorders. Researchers correlate recurrent tornado dreams with periods of high work stress, family crises, or stressful life transitions. From a cognitive-behavioral therapy perspective, these dreams reflect catastrophic thinking and perceived lack of control. Emotional processing therapies work with these images to help patients develop coping strategies for situations they perceive as overwhelming.
Variations of dreaming about tornado
Tornado approaching but not arriving
This dream suggests anticipatory anxiety about a potential problem that hasn't yet materialized. It indicates you're spending mental energy worrying about catastrophic scenarios that might never occur. It may be a sign to focus on the present rather than obsessing over hypothetical futures.
Flying inside a tornado
Dreaming that you're flying inside the tornado's eye represents a search for center and calm amidst chaos. It symbolizes your ability to maintain perspective even in turbulent situations. It may indicate you're finding spiritual or intellectual clarity amid confusing or stressful circumstances.
Tornado with unusual colors
A red tornado may symbolize uncontrolled passion or intense anger; a green one could represent jealousy or forced growth; a golden one may indicate valuable though painful spiritual transformation. Colors add layers of emotional and spiritual meaning to the basic tornado interpretation.
Multiple simultaneous tornadoes
This dream indicates you feel overwhelmed by multiple crises or sources of stress in your waking life. Each tornado may represent a different area of conflict (work, family, health, finances). The direction the tornadoes move (convergent or divergent) suggests whether these problems are interconnected or independent.
Protecting others from the tornado
If you dream of protecting loved ones from the tornado, you reflect a strong caregiving instinct and sense of responsibility. It may indicate you feel like the support pillar in your family or community during difficult times. It could also point to overprotective tendencies or difficulty delegating responsibilities in crisis situations.
Frequently asked questions about dreaming of tornado
Does dreaming of a tornado always mean something bad?
Not necessarily. Although tornadoes are often associated with destruction, in the dream context they can symbolize positive transformation, emotional cleansing, or the necessary dissolution of obsolete structures in your life. The meaning depends on the dream's outcome and your emotions during it.
Why do I dream about tornadoes repeatedly?
Recurrent tornado dreams usually indicate an unresolved problem or ongoing stressful situation in your waking life. Your unconscious is trying to draw attention to repressed emotions, internal conflicts, or external circumstances that make you feel out of control. Keeping a dream journal is recommended to identify patterns.
What does it mean if the tornado doesn't harm me in the dream?
If the tornado doesn't cause you physical harm, it suggests you have internal resources to navigate chaotic situations without suffering permanent emotional damage. It may indicate resilience, spiritual protection, or awareness that external problems cannot affect your essential core. It could also reflect denial or lack of awareness about the true impact of certain situations on your life.
Can tornadoes in dreams predict real disasters?
There's no scientific evidence that dreams can predict specific events like natural disasters. However, some spiritual traditions and people with high intuitive sensitivity report precognitive dreams. Psychologically, these dreams are more likely to reflect subconscious anxiety about perceived vulnerabilities or general fears of catastrophes, especially if you live in tornado-prone areas.
